Comprehending Crypto Exchange Fees
Before diving into the specifics, it's necessary to comprehend the various types of fees that Crypto Exchanges With Lowest Fees exchanges generally enforce:
Trading Fees: These are the fees charged for performing a trade. They can be charged as a percentage of the trade amount or a flat fee.Withdrawal Fees: Exchanges frequently charge a fee for transferring your funds off their platform. This fee differs based on the cryptocurrency being withdrawn.Deposit Fees: Some exchanges might charge a fee for transferring funds, although lots of do not.Lack of exercise Fees: Some platforms impose fees on accounts that stay inactive for a certain duration.
By knowing these fees, traders can choose an exchange that lines up with their trading practices and monetary goals.

Make certain to read the fine print before committing to a platform.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What is the difference between trading fees and withdrawal fees?
Trading fees are sustained when you purchase or sell cryptocurrency on an exchange, while withdrawal fees are charged when you transfer your cryptocurrency off the exchange to another wallet.
2. How can I decrease my trading fees?
A lot of exchanges use discounts for using their native token to spend for fees. In addition, trading in larger volumes often leads to lower fees.
3. Is a higher trading fee always a negative?
Not always. A higher fee might be justified if the exchange offers remarkable features, security, client support, or reliability.
4. Are there any exchanges without fees?
While some platforms may provide no trading fees on defined trades or promos, they typically compensate for this through higher withdrawal fees or other charges.
5. Can I trust exchanges with low fees?
Low fees do not constantly equate to a lack of security or service. Research study the exchange's track record, user reviews, and regulatory compliance to ensure they are reliable.
